The Samurai (2014)
The deadliest thing from Germany since 1945!
Jakob, a young policeman from a remote village, has his world unhinged when a stranger in a dress emerges from the forest and begins killing villagers with a sword.
Director: Till Kleinert
Genre: Thriller, Horror, Fantasy
Runtime: 80 min
Release Date: February 8, 2014
